Subject: [PATCH v2 3/8] ath9k: Fix antenna diversity init for AR9565
Date: Mon,  2 Sep 2013 13:59:01 +0530	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1378110546-22305-3-git-send-email-sujith@msujith.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1378110546-22305-1-git-send-email-sujith@msujith.org>

From: Sujith Manoharan <c_manoha@qca.qualcomm.com>

Program the HW registers (AR_PHY_CCK_DETECT, AR_PHY_MC_GAIN_CTRL)
with the correct values for AR9565 to allow LNA combining.
